How to Evaluate Quality When Shopping at a Furniture Showroom
Shopping for furniture can be an exciting journey, especially when visiting a home furniture showroom near you. However, it’s essential to evaluate the quality of the items you’re considering to ensure your investment is worthwhile. Here are some effective strategies to help you gauge the quality of furniture when exploring showrooms.
Understand Different Materials
Furniture comes in various materials, each affecting durability, look, and feel. It’s crucial to know what to look for:
- Wood: Solid wood offers durability and strength. Look for hardwoods like oak, maple, or cherry for longevity.
- Particleboard: Often used for budget-friendly pieces, it’s less durable and prone to damage from moisture.
- Metal: Metal frames provide sturdiness, especially for beds and outdoor pieces.
- Upholstery: Fabrics should feel durable. Check for high thread counts in textiles and robust materials like leather or microfiber.
Check Construction Quality
The way furniture is constructed plays a significant role in its overall quality. Here’s what to inspect:
- Joint Construction: Look for doweled joints or mortise-and-tenon joints rather than staples or glue for added strength.
- Frame Stability: Shake the piece gently; there should be no creaking or wobbling if it’s made well.
- Safety Features: For items like dressers and shelves, ensure they come with anti-tip features for safety.
Inspect Finishes and Details
The finish of the furniture can indicate how well it has been made. High-quality finishes are smooth, even, and enrich the natural look of the wood. Here are details to keep an eye on:
- Paint and Stain: Check for consistency and apply smoothly without drips or uneven patches.
- Hardware: Examine knobs, pulls, and hinges. Quality hardware will feel sturdy, not flimsy.
- Padding and Comfort: For upholstered items, sit down and test the comfort level and support it provides.
Test the Functionality
Take the time to examine how functional a piece of furniture is. Here are some tips on assessing functionality:
- Drawers and Doors: Open and close drawers to ensure they operate smoothly. Check for alignment and ease of use.
- Adjustable Features: If a piece has adjustable components, like reclining seats or extendable tables, test these features thoroughly.
- Assembly Requirements: Understand how a piece comes together. Legs that need to be attached might affect stability.
Consider the Warranty
Receiving a warranty can reflect a manufacturer’s confidence in their product. A good warranty usually covers:
- Defects in materials and workmanship for a specific period.
- Replacement options or repair services should any issues arise.

Consider Your Space
Each room in your home has its own dimensions and function. Measure your space to ensure the furniture you choose fits well within it. A good rule of thumb is to leave adequate walking space around furniture pieces. Typically, aim for:
| Room Type | Recommended Space Around Furniture |
|---|---|
| Living Room | 18-24 inches |
| Dining Room | 36 inches |
| Bedroom | 24-30 inches |
Understanding these measurements helps you visualize how the furniture will fit into your home and prevents overcrowding, ensuring your space remains functional and inviting.

Think About Your Lifestyle
Consider how you and your family will use the furniture. If you have pets or young children, opt for fabrics that are easy to clean and durable, such as microfiber or leather. If you entertain frequently, consider larger seating options or extendable dining tables that accommodate more guests.
